Por qué operamos este programa en Del Mar

Del Mar's 2.5-mile coastline produces some of the cleanest water and most consistent small waves in the region, protected by the San Dieguito River mouth eddies. Our 15th Street Beach lessons sit in front of Powerhouse Park, which doubles as our outdoor classroom. We partner with Del Mar Union's Del Mar Heights and Ashley Falls Elementary — serving primarily inland Del Mar Mesa and Carmel Valley neighborhoods.

Dónde surfeamos en Del Mar

15th Street Beach

Principiante

Un Mar's primary Del Mar location, directly in front of Powerhouse Park — which doubles as our outdoor classroom space.

15th Street sits in the heart of Del Mar Village, adjacent to Powerhouse Park, the historic 1928 beach concession building that gives the park its name.

Fondo: SandOleaje: 1–3 ft typicalSalvavidas: Todo el año

Currículo del programa

Our summer surf camps run Monday through Friday across North County and San Diego, serving BIPOC youth ages 6–17. Each one-week cohort combines four mornings of in-water surf instruction with afternoon programming in marine ecology, Kumeyaay coastal history, and cultural arts. Camps are capped at 18 students per cohort to maintain a 4:1 student-to-instructor ratio, and every camp ends with a Friday family showcase on the beach. Camps are entirely free — wetsuits, boards, transportation, daily lunch, and all materials included.

  • Daily in-water surf instruction (4 hrs/day)
  • Marine ecology & watershed education
  • Cultural arts workshops (painting, poetry, storytelling)
  • Kumeyaay coastal history and stewardship
  • Nutrition and hydration for athletes
  • Friday family showcase and celebration

Por qué Un Mar de Colores

Un Mar de Colores is a BIPOC-led 501(c)(3) nonprofit founded in Oceanside, California in 2018. Our instructors are certified by the San Diego Fire-Rescue Lifeguard Division and hold CPR + First Aid credentials.

Preguntas frecuentes — Surf Camp en Del Mar

Can my child continue after surf camp ends?+

Yes — camp graduates connect to year-round free surf lessons, Ocean Stewards after-school for teens, and the Surf Athletic Scholarship pathway. Camp is an entry point, not a dead end for Del Mar youth.

How many students are in each surf camp cohort?+

Each cohort caps at 18 students with a 4:1 student-to-instructor ratio. Small cohorts keep nervous first-timers from Del Mar from getting lost in overcrowded lineups — every child gets coached attention daily.

When do Del Mar surf camp cohorts run?+

Summer camps run June through August with Monday–Friday cohorts. Cohorts fill 3–4 weeks ahead — contact us early if you're enrolling from Del Mar for a specific week. Priority goes to Title I referrals and partner org introductions.

¿Los programas de Surf Camp en Del Mar son realmente gratuitos?+

Sí. Todos los programas de Un Mar de Colores en Del Mar son 100% gratuitos. Proporcionamos trajes de neopreno 3/2mm, tablas de surf, transporte desde escuelas asociadas como Del Mar Heights Elementary, Ashley Falls Elementary, e instrucción bilingüe certificada. El financiamiento proviene de la San Diego Foundation, subvenciones comunitarias y donantes individuales.

¿Dónde se realizan exactamente las lecciones en Del Mar?+

Las lecciones principales se realizan en 15th Street Beach. Todas las sesiones de agua ocurren dentro de las zonas salvavidas de la bandera.

¿Qué edades son elegibles en Del Mar?+

Servimos a jóvenes de 6–17 años. Nuestra Beca One Ocean cubre las edades 6-12, Ocean Stewards After-School sirve a 13-17, y las Becas Atléticas de Surf están disponibles para jóvenes competitivos a través de nuestras asociaciones con Del Mar Union School District.
